Prints Sir William Wroth's speech, p. 5-8, along with "The heads of the propositions in His Maiesties letter".

Annotation on Thomason copy: "1642 March. 7."; the 3 in the imprint date has been crossed out.Citation/references Wing (2nd ed., 1994), C2397
